Instructions:

This is one of the easiest cookie recipes you will make! Simply, mash two bananas, add oats and chocolate chip and stir in. Chill the dough in the fridge while your oven preheats. Bake cookies for 15 to 20 minutes and cool before serving. These cookies do not spread and will bake thick if simply scooped and dropped onto the sheet. I like to flatten them just a bit.

The taste:

These cookies are chewy and thick. The longer you bake them, the more chance the edges will crisp up, especially the mashed banana part. Obviously, they won't have the texture or taste of cookies baked with flour and sugar, so keep that in mind. However, these cookies are very satisfying if you are looking for a sweet-tasting treat that's healthy. You can use different add-ons in place of chocolate chips for more texture.

The base of the recipe is the mashed banana and oats mixture. You can bake it just like that, without the chocolate chips OR you can make lots of variations: dark chocolate chunk, white chocolate and coconut, dried fruit, etc.

Prep Time 5 mins

Cook Time 15 mins

Total Time 20 mins

Course Dessert

Cuisine American

Servings 15 cookies

Calories 69 kcal

  • 2 medium bananas
  • 1 cup old-fashioned oats
  • 1/2 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ips see note

  • In a medium mixing bowl, mash bananas.

  • Add oats and chocolate chips and stir well.

  •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and place in the fridge.

  • In the meantime, line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.

  • When your oven is ready, scoop the dough with a medium size (1 and 1/2 tablespoon size) cookie scoop and place on prepared sheet.

  • Bake cookies for 15 to 18 minutes.

  • Cool for 2 to 3 minutes on sheet, then transfer onto a cooling rack.

Should Banana Oatmeal Cookies be refrigerated?

Banana oatmeal cookies should be stored in an airtight container at room temperature for 3 days. Banana oatmeal cookies do not need to be refrigerated, but if stored in the refrigerator the cookies will last longer (about 5 to 7 days).
